What we practice.

Everything the firm takes on arrives as one of these engagements. Each is personal, runs in confidence, and moves on the search’s own clock.

i
Permanent Search
Confidential, personally led searches for studio heads, programming and content executives, label leadership, agency partners, and network executives. Each engagement runs its own arc; none are accelerated to fit an upfront or a slate announcement.
ii
Leadership Assessment
Structured evaluation of finalists for senior content and operating roles. Used during active searches to surface fit beyond the deal sheet, and engaged stand-alone by studios, labels, and agencies evaluating internal succession.
iii
Succession Planning
Multi-year advisory engagements for studios, networks, and labels facing leadership transition. Pipeline development before a chair opens, with a written succession point of view.
iv
Board & Trustee Advisory
Composition guidance for media-company boards, label parent groups, and agency holding companies seeking content and operating talent at the director level.
